FAQ


 

1.      How is Bank of Kigali organized?


Bank of Kigali is organized into two major segments - Corporate & SME Banking and Retail Banking.

 

2.      Who is Bank of Kigali’s External Auditor?


Bank of Kigali’s External Auditor is KPMG Rwanda.

 

3.      What is Bank of Kigali’s current rating?


Bank of Kigali is rated AA-/A1 by Global Credit Rating Company. 

 

4.      When is Bank of Kigali’s year end?


Bank of Kigali’s year end is 31 December.

 

5.      What is the ticker symbol for Bank of Kigali shares and on which exchanges does it    trade?


Bank of Kigali shares trade on the Rwanda Stock Exchange under Ticker number “BOK”

 

6.      What was the offering price at Bank of Kigali's Initial Public Offering (IPO)?


Bank of Kigali went public on 1 September, 2011 at Rwf 125 per share.

 

7.      What is Bank of Kigali’s dividend policy?


Bank of Kigali has adopted a dividend payout policy; the dividend payout ratio shall equal 50% of the Bank’s audited IFRS-based Net Income in respect of 2011, 2012 and 2013.

 

8.      When was the last dividend declared?

 

The Annual General Meeting of Shareholders held on 27th April 2012 approved a Dividend for the year ended 31 December 2011 of Rwf 4,344,382,984 (US$ 7.2 million).The Dividend per share equalled RwF 6.5, resulting in the dividend yield of 5.2%. The dividend was paid from 9 May 2012.

 

9.      What tax is applicable on dividends?


Dividends are subject to withholding tax of 5% for resident tax payers of the East African Community and 15% for non-resident tax payers of the East African Community.
